What is an autotroph?
Back
An organism that produces its own food, typically through photosynthesis.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a heterotroph?
Back
An organism that cannot produce its own food and must consume other organisms.

Define carrying capacity.
Back
The maximum number of individuals of a species that an environment can support sustainably.
